使用Vue.js数据绑定需要一段时间是因为Vue.js是一种基于JavaScript的前端框架,它通过双向数据绑定的方式实现了数据与视图的自动同步更新。在使用Vue.js进行数据绑定时,需要经历以下几个步骤:
- 引入Vue.js:首先需要在HTML文件中引入Vue.js的库文件,可以通过CDN方式引入或者下载到本地引入。
- 创建Vue实例:在JavaScript代码中,需要创建一个Vue实例来管理数据和视图的绑定关系。可以通过new Vue()来创建一个Vue实例。
- 定义数据:在Vue实例中,需要定义需要绑定的数据。可以在data属性中定义各种数据,这些数据将会与视图进行绑定。
- 绑定数据:在HTML文件中,可以使用Vue的指令来将数据与视图进行绑定。常用的指令有v-bind、v-model、v-for等,通过这些指令可以将数据绑定到HTML元素的属性、内容或者事件上。
- 数据更新:当数据发生变化时,Vue会自动更新视图,保持数据与视图的同步。可以通过修改Vue实例中的数据来触发视图的更新。
Vue.js的数据绑定具有以下优势:
- 响应式:Vue.js使用了响应式的数据绑定机制,当数据发生变化时,视图会自动更新,无需手动操作DOM。
- 简洁易用:Vue.js提供了简洁的语法和丰富的指令,使得数据绑定的操作变得简单易懂。
- 高效性能:Vue.js采用了虚拟DOM技术,通过最小化DOM操作来提高性能。
- 组件化开发:Vue.js支持组件化开发,可以将页面拆分成多个组件,提高代码的复用性和可维护性。
Vue.js的数据绑定适用于各种前端开发场景,特别适合构建交互性强、数据驱动的单页面应用(SPA)。
腾讯云提供了一系列与Vue.js相关的产品和服务,包括云服务器、云数据库、云存储等,可以满足前端开发和部署的需求。具体产品和介绍可以参考腾讯云官网的相关页面:腾讯云产品介绍。